About this artwork
“The Assumption of the Virgin” is a work by Francesco Rosselli (Italian, 1448-about 1513), dated c. 1495. It is executed in engraving printed on two sheets from two plates and classified as print. US vs EU note: in the United States a faithful photographic reproduction of a public-domain 2-D artwork carries no new copyright (Bridgeman v. Corel), which is the basis of these open-access programmes. EU Directive 2019/790 Art. 14 similarly provides that reproductions of public-domain visual works are not protected. If reusing commercially in another jurisdiction, satisfy yourself of the local position. See the full licence note.
